Edward A. LeLacheur Park—commonly known as LeLacheur Park—is a scenic, mid-sized baseball stadium located along the banks of the Merrimack River in Lowell, Massachusetts. Opened in 1998, it was built as part of the city’s broader revitalization effort and is now owned and operated by the University of Massachusetts Lowell.
The ballpark has a seating capacity of just under 5,000, giving it an intimate, fan-friendly atmosphere where spectators are close to the action. Its design features a raised seating bowl with a wraparound concourse at the top, allowing fans to grab concessions or walk the park while still maintaining clear views of the field.
